A displacement reaction is a type of reaction where one element is displaced by another from a compound.

In the case of magnesium and lead nitrate, magnesium is more reactive than lead. Therefore, it will displace lead from lead nitrate to form magnesium nitrate and lead.

The reaction can be represented as:

Mg(s) + Pb(NO3)2(aq) → Mg(NO3)2(aq) + Pb(s)
